Step-by-step explanation:

By inscribed angle theorem:

[tex] m\angle C = \frac{1}{2} m(\widehat{AD}) [/tex]

[tex] \therefore m\angle C = \frac{1}{2}\times 94\degree [/tex]

[tex]\huge \purple {\boxed {\therefore m\angle C = 47\degree}} [/tex]

Again by inscribed angle theorem:

[tex] m\angle A = \frac{1}{2} m(\widehat{BC}) [/tex]

[tex] \therefore 48\degree = \frac{1}{2} m(\widehat{BC}) [/tex]

[tex] \therefore 48\degree\times 2 = m(\widehat{BC}) [/tex]

[tex] \huge \red {\boxed {\therefore m(\widehat{BC}) =96\degree}} [/tex]
